Product Description

The 3300/16-15-01-01-00-00-01 is a dual-channel radial vibration and shaft position monitor within the Bently Nevada 3300 rack system. It converts signals from proximity probes into precise displacement measurements, enabling real-time detection of imbalance, misalignment, or bearing wear.

This module is optimized for 0–10 mils peak-to-peak full-scale range, making it ideal for large fluid-film bearing machines such as steam turbines, centrifugal compressors, and industrial fans. With a response latency under 1 millisecond, it ensures rapid trip signals to prevent catastrophic equipment damage.


Technical Specifications

Specification Description
Model Designation 3300/16
Full Order Code 3300/16-15-01-01-00-00-01
Primary Function Radial shaft vibration and axial position monitoring
Full-Scale Measurement 0–10 mils peak-to-peak (pp)
Input Channels Two independent channels for Proximitor sensors
Transducer Compatibility Bently Nevada 3300 (5mm) & 3300 XL (8mm) Proximity Probes
Proximitor Supply -17.5 VDC to -26 VDC with non-incendive protection
Analog Output 4–20 mA DC for PLC/DCS integration
System Latency <1 ms for alarm/trip activation
Power Consumption Max 12 mA per transducer
Operating Temperature -40°C to +85°C
Dimensions 5.8 × 20.3 × 2.5 cm
Weight 1.0 kg

Application Scenarios

  • Turbine Supervisory Instrumentation (TSI) in power plants

  • Oil refineries and chemical processing facilities

  • Monitoring fluid-film bearing machines, including large centrifugal compressors, steam turbines, and industrial fans

  • Critical for early detection of radial shaft movement to prevent equipment failure


Technical FAQ

Can this module work with older 7200 series Proximitor sensors?

  • Yes. It is backward compatible, provided the scale factor (mV/mil) is correctly calibrated to match the monitor’s input range.

How does supply voltage affect measurement accuracy?

  • Designed for a -24 V supply. Operating above -23 V may reduce the linear range of the proximity probe and affect high-vibration measurement accuracy.
